O único aperitivo autêntico na vinha da Toscana. É uma história de paixão, de agricultores e lugares históricos: uma vinícola fora do caminho batido, longe da multidão, mas perto das tradições da Toscana. Eu vou pegar você na sua em Lucca com a minha van profissional, e eu vou conduzi-lo através das colinas da Toscana. Começaremos nosso passeio com um passeio na vinha e visitaremos a adega onde você descobrirá todos os segredos do vinho toscano, graças às explicações e as histórias de vida do fazendeiro. Em seguida, você vai provar os vinhos da produção desfrutando de uma verdadeira atmosfera toscana. Cada vinho será combinado com alguns produtos do jardim e algumas especialidades, como salami e queijo pecorino da Toscana.. um mergulho na cultura da mesa da Toscana! Lembre-se: não é um almoço completo... é sobre aprender a combinar vinho e comida :) "Não é só beber vinho: queremos fazer você conhecer a verdadeira Toscana, queremos contar a história de nossas raízes"

Itinerário
Você terá a oportunidade de visitar uma bela vinícola com uma vista deslumbrante: faremos um tour pela adega e você descobrirá todos os segredos do processo de vinificação. Depois você fará a degustação... que é a melhor parte! Depois de todo o seu tempo relaxante na vinha, vou levá-lo de volta a Pisa.
